During a pre flight / ground handle check today, one of my students found that a Karabiner on one of our ground handling training harnesses had a fault. The pin that the main gate pivots on to open and close, was almost ll the way out. If the Karabiners were used for flight and the pin came out the gate would have simply fell away leaving it open.
